Detailed Interpretation
When interpreting dreams of conflict, it\'s beneficial to draw from various cultural and psychological lenses. In ancient American cultures, such as the Mayans and Native Americans, conflict could symbolize a necessary transformation or a call to action. Fighting might represent the struggle between good and evil, a theme prevalent in many mythologies.
From a Christian perspective, conflict can signify a spiritual battle, urging individuals to seek peace and reconciliation.
Modern psychology, particularly through the lenses of Freud and Jung, views fighting in dreams as an expression of repressed emotions or unresolved tensions. Freud might suggest that the dream reflects inner desires or fears, while Jung would interpret the fighting as a manifestation of the shadow self, indicating aspects of the personality that need integration.
